| Trance Nutter |
I've finally got a digicam, so at last I can post here!
Had this set up for about a year, mixer for 6 months
Gear:
2x Numark 1650 Turntables
2x Ortofon Concorde Pro Silver
Vestax PCV-275 mixer
Sony MDR-V6 Headphones (aka 7506)
Some old school stereo that can blow away the majority of stereos today.:D
Thats a custom built booth, was surprised how well it turned out, just about every measurement fitted exactly. Took me about 3 weeks to build so it better have bloody fitted! And as you can see on the last photo all the cables drop inside, makes it look really clean on top.
Feel free to PM or ask me any questions if you are looking to do something similar. |
